Steve Smith scored 78 runs with 8 fours, in 196 balls to help his team Australia put up a fight against Pakistan's 476/5d. On the other side, a pitch where none of the bowlers could pick up more than a wicket each, including the likes of Cummins, Starc & Shaheen Afridi, Nauman had already picked up 3 wickets as he set his eyes on arguably Australia's best batter, Steve Smith.
The 32-year old Australian was smacking the bowlers effortlessly through the off-side, using the room if and when provided to dispatch the ball for runs. This is when the Pakistan team came up with a tactic to deal with Smith's challenge. On the first step, the Pakistani bowlers bowled outside the leg stump to limit Steve Smith's freedom of scoring on the off-side.
